Essential Deep Cleaning Tasks Before Moving Into a New Place

Deep cleaning can help eliminate dust, allergens, and any remnants left by previous occupants. Here’s a detailed guide on what to deep clean before moving into your new residence.

1. Kitchen: The kitchen is often the heart of the home and should be a top priority for deep cleaning. Start by cleaning the refrigerator, both inside and out. Remove shelves and drawers, wash them with warm soapy water, and wipe down the interior with a disinfectant. Next, tackle the oven and stove. Use a degreaser for the stovetop and clean the oven with a suitable cleaner, ensuring to remove any burnt-on food. Don’t forget to clean the microwave, dishwasher, and other appliances. Wipe down countertops, cabinets, and backsplashes, and thoroughly clean the sink and faucet.

2. Bathrooms: Bathrooms require special attention due to moisture and bacteria. Start by scrubbing the toilet with a toilet cleaner and brush, and wipe down the exterior with disinfectant. Clean the shower or bathtub with a mold and mildew remover, and scrub tiles and grout to remove any stains. Wipe down the sink, countertop, and mirrors with glass cleaner. Don’t forget to clean fixtures and any cabinets or drawers inside the bathroom.

3. Floors: Floors can harbor dust and dirt, so deep cleaning them is essential. Vacuum carpets thoroughly and consider steam cleaning if they appear stained or worn. For hardwood, laminate, or tile floors, sweep and mop using a suitable cleaner for the specific flooring type. Pay special attention to corners and under appliances where dirt tends to accumulate.

4. Windows and Doors: Clean windows inside and out to allow natural light to flood in. Use a glass cleaner and a microfiber cloth for a streak-free finish. Don’t forget to clean window sills and tracks. Wipe down doors, including doorknobs and handles, with disinfectant to remove any germs or residues.

5. Walls and Baseboards: Walls can accumulate dust, fingerprints, and stains. Use a damp cloth or sponge to wipe down walls, especially in high-traffic areas. For stubborn stains, a mild detergent can be used. Clean baseboards with a damp cloth or a vacuum attachment to remove dust and dirt buildup.

6. Closets and Storage Spaces: Before placing your belongings in closets, give them a thorough clean. Wipe down shelves and vacuum or mop the floors inside. This ensures that your clothes and belongings are stored in a clean environment.

7. Air Vents and Filters: Don’t overlook the importance of clean air quality. Dust and allergens can accumulate in air vents and filters. Remove and clean or replace air filters, and use a vacuum to clean air vents to improve the air quality in your new home.

Conclusion: Deep cleaning your new place before moving in may seem daunting, but it’s a worthwhile investment of time and effort. A clean environment not only provides a fresh start but also promotes better health and well-being. By addressing these essential areas, you can ensure that your new home is not only welcoming but also a safe and healthy space for you and your family. Happy moving!
